This book has everything, Malorie Blackman's writing, a forbidden romance, murder mystery and it's set in space! So why did I leave it on hiatus for over a year?
I don't like dnf-ing books but then I put this book back on the shelf and found I had very little motivation to finish reading it. I didn't particularly connect to any of the characters but especially the main romance and its drama, I just had no interest in reading about. And the murder mystery, one of my favourite genres, felt very pushed to the side. It's hard to talk properly about this book given I read the first half so long ago but I will say the major reveal of the book I felt was well done. I will go back and re read this whole book one day and maybe then I'll enjoy it more. Or I'll just be reminded why I struggled to finish reading it the first time. A bit disappointing but mainly due to me having such high standards for it

I wanted to like this a lot more than I did. I loved the idea of a space-age, dystopian, gender-swapped Shakespearean retelling, but nothing particularly stood out to me.

It's good for light reading and I really adore Blackmans work, but I could not get lost in this story.
